Fuel Tank Reading

Fuel Tank readings is for entry of stick readings from the stations tanks. By entering the readings, My Pricebook  will keep a history for reporting.
Please follow the steps below to enter your readings

1. Click in Tank Code 
Click in Tank code to start entering reading.

2. Enter Tank Code 
Select Tank Code from drop down arrow.

3. Enter Water Depth 
Enter Water depth in inches. Entry is not required.

4. Enter Fuel Depth 
Enter Fuel Depth in inches. Entry is not required.

5. Enter Fuel Gallons
Enter Fuel gallons.
If a Tank Chart has been set up and the Water and Fuel depths have been entered, the Fuel gallons will automatically calculate. This can be overridden. For more information about Tank Charts see Tank Setup in Settings.

6. Click the Save button
Click the Save button in the Navigation Bar which will be active.
If you need to enter more Readings, Click Insert in the Nav Bar and go to Step 1.

7. Complete Tank Readings
When everything looks good, click the 'Tank Readings Complete' button. Tank Readings must be complete to complete the Day.

Corrections can always be made before the Day is completed. Please note, anytime changes are made to the grid, the checkmarks will go away and the Complete button needs to be clicked again.
